Definitions
Back SMYC Forward
  • Geocoding:
    • The process of finding the coordinates of an object on the surface of the Earth (or other celestial body)
  • Digitizing:
    • The process of creating an electronic/digital representation (usually a vector representation) of a geometric shape

Geocoding Street Addresses (cont.)
Back SMYC Forward
  • One Approach:
    • Digitize street intersections
    • Determine the collection of addresses on each segment
    • Interpolate individual addresses
  • Collections of Addresses:
    • Actual low and high address
    • Potential low and high address
    • List of actual addresses

Common Problems when Geocoding Street Addresses
Back SMYC Forward
  • Digitizing Problems:
    • Intersections with incorrect coordinates
  • Address Collection Problems:
    • Missing collections
    • Gaps in ranges
    • Confusion about odd and even sides
    • Duplicate names
  • Interpolation Problems:
    • Words for numbers (e.g., "One" for "1")
    • Spelling mistakes/differences
    • "Route number" and name for a single segment
    • Multiple names for a single segment
    • Abbreviations (e.g., "Port" for "Port Republic", "3rd" for "third")
Geocoding (Land-Line) Telephone Numbers
Back SMYC Forward
  • Direct Approach:
    • Digitize telephone poles or conduits or street intersections
    • Determine the collection of phone numbers on each segment
    • Interpolate individual telephone numbers
  • Indirect Approach:
    • Associate each phone number with a street address
    • Geocode the street address
Geocoding (Static) Internet Addresses
Back SMYC Forward
  • One Approach:
    • Collect the coordinates for each IP address
  • Another Approach:
    • Collect the coordinates of "large" routers/servers
    • Collect the set of "nearby" IP addresses
    • Interpolate individual IP addresses
